Ajman Ruler honours 235 CUCA graduates

AJMAN / WAM

HH Sheikh Humaid bin Rashid Al Nuaimi, Supreme Council Member and Ruler of Ajman, attended the graduation ceremony of the first batch of City University College of Ajman (CUCA). Some 235 students from various colleges were honoured.
The honouring ceremony was attended by HH Sheikh Ammar bin Humaid Al Nuaimi, Crown Prince of Ajman, Sheikh Rashid bin Humaid Al Nuaimi, Chairman of the Municipality and Planning Department in Ajman and Chairman of the Board of Directors of City University of Ajman, and Sheikh Nahyan bin Mubarak Al Nahyan, Minister of Culture and Knowledge Development.
The ceremony was also attended by a number of Sheikhs, senior officials, university officials, a number of ambassadors accredited to the UAE, heads of departments and parents.
The Ruler congratulated the graduates and their parents, saying that graduation of this batch is deemed the first of the college in the context of the strategy aimed at building new colleges and universities supported by the wise leadership of President His Highness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Vice President and Prime Minister and Ruler of Dubai, His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, and Their Highnesses Members of Supreme Council and The Rulers of Emirates, who always set plans and programmes to develop education.
Wishing graduates success and luck in their practical life and labour markets, he pointed out that the new batch represents a true asset of the UAE. He also emphasised that this new edifice is deemed one of the universities that focusses on building human resources.
At the end of the ceremony, the Ajman Ruler, along with others, honoured the outstanding and distinguished graduates. Meanwhile, Sheikh Humaid distributed graduation certificates to the graduates. The Ruler of Ajman, Crown Prince and Sheikh Nahyan received the medal of the university as souvenirs.
